Bhavesh Jogani IT Ответов: 1

АСП. Объем пользовательской роли представить не работает в виртуальных подрубрике каталога в IIS


Привет,
Я создал два проекта в asp .net mvc и angular. Один для передней панели и второй для админ-панели. Я использовал пользовательский поставщик ролей в своем проекте администратора. Я хочу настроить front в главном виртуальном каталоге и admin в подпапке в качестве виртуального каталога. Когда я запускаю веб-сайт с front работает нормально, но когда я запускаю admin website, который размещен как sub virtual directory, поставщик ролей не вызывается. Пожалуйста, направьте меня, если у кого-то есть какие-то идеи.

Что я уже пробовал:

у меня настроить его на мой локальный веб-сервер IIS

1 Ответов

Рейтинг:
0

Richard Deeming

Откройте сайт в диспетчере IIS. Щелкните правой кнопкой мыши на виртуальном каталоге администратора и выберите пункт "преобразовать в приложение".


Bhavesh Jogani IT

- Привет, Ричард.. спасибо за ваш ответ..Я уже сделал это. Когда я попытался использовать его в качестве основного домена, то он работает нормально, но он не работает при настройке его в суб-виртуальном каталоге(приложении)..

Richard Deeming

Тогда вам нужно будет объяснить, что означает "не работает".

Попробуйте открыть сайт в браузере, работающем на сервере; это должно дать вам более подробное сообщение об ошибке.

Bhavesh Jogani IT

когда я размещаю свой веб-сайт администратора в IIS в качестве суб-виртуального каталога, то пользовательский поставщик ролей не работает, это означает роли поставщика ролей.IsUserInRole не называется.Так как я предоставляю роль для разных пользователей, все меню скрыто, даже я назначаю роли.